Where we are      
The neighborhood is roughly bordered by State Street on the
south, the Oregon State Fair property on the north, the Union
Pacific railroad on the west, with a slight jog westerly around
Parrish Middle School and the surrounding neighborhood, and
24th Avenue NE on the east.

Who we are  

NorthEast Neighbors (NEN) encompasses a beautiful, historic part
of Salem, including the Court-Chemeketa Historic District, which is
listed on the
National Register of Historical Places.  It contains two
parks, State Offices,
Olinger Pool, Englewood Elementary School,
Parrish Middle School, North Salem High School,  four churches,
historic buildings, and over 2,000 households dating from the late
1800s to the present
.
